How much does homeschooling cost in NY?

Homeschooling is neither cheap nor easy. The average cost of homeschooling ranges from $700 to $1,800 per child per school year, according to Time4Learning.com, an online resource for homeschool families. This includes the cost of the curriculum, school supplies, field trips and extracurricular activities.

How many hours are required for homeschooling in NY?

Attendance requirements. The cumulative hours of instruction for grades 1 through 6 shall be 900 hours per year. The cumulative hours of instruction for grades 7 through 12 shall be 990 hours per year. Absences shall be permitted on the same basis as provided in the policy of the school district for its own students.

Do homeschooled students take standardized tests in NY?

A. No. Tests that are mandated by the State are not required to be taken by the homeschooled student. These tests were intended to measure New York State curriculum.

Do moms get paid to homeschool?

Homeschooling your child is a private choice and is not employment. Therefore, parents do not get paid to homeschool their children. However, in some states families may receive a tax credit, deduction, or even a stipend if homeschooling under an umbrella school (like a charter school).

What do I need to homeschool in NY?

Requirements for Homeschooling in NYS

  1. File a notice of intent to homeschool within 14 days of beginning, and every year thereafter.
  2. Provide an Individualized Home Instruction plan to the District Superintendent.
  3. Note the subjects required to be taught at specific grade levels.
  4. Maintain attendance records.

How do I start homeschooling my child in New York?

Parents who wish to home school their children must provide written notice of intent to the school district superintendent. The school district must then respond to the family and provide a copy of the home instruction regulations as well as an individualized home instruction plan (IHIP) form to complete.
